Job Description

This individual reports to the Middle School Division Director and is responsible for providing administrative support to this position as well as assisting the Director in supporting middle school faculty and students. These support functions include, but are not limited to: database system maintenance (Blackbaud My School App), office supply purchasing, drafting/sending communications, filing, reception duties, scheduling substitute teachers, responding to faculty and family messages and correspondence, providing information and responding to inquiries, and disseminating information internally. This position also helps coordinate middle school activities and events including, but not limited to, back to school night, science fair, art show, ISEE prep and on-site test, field trips, outdoor education trips, Step-Up, and 8th grade graduation. Additional responsibilities include supervisory duties, serving as an activities facilitator (as needed), serving as a substitute teacher for uncovered teacher absences, and participation in various student and community activities.
